use std::future::Future;
use http::Method;
use serde::{Deserialize, Serialize};
use crate::body::NoneBody;
use crate::error::Result;
use crate::response::BodyResponseProcessor;
use crate::ser::OnlyKeyField;
use crate::{Client, Ops, Prepared, Request};
#[derive(Debug, Clone, Default, Serialize)]
pub struct GetVectorBucketParams {
#[serde(rename = "bucketInfo")]
bucket_info: OnlyKeyField,
}
#[derive(Debug, Clone, Default, PartialEq, Eq, Deserialize, Serialize)]
#[serde(rename_all = "PascalCase")]
pub struct VectorBucketInfo {
pub name: String,
pub creation_date: Option<String>,
pub extranet_endpoint: Option<String>,
pub intranet_endpoint: Option<String>,
pub location: Option<String>,
pub region: Option<String>,
}
#[derive(Debug, Clone, Default, Deserialize)]
#[serde(rename_all = "PascalCase")]
pub struct GetVectorBucketResult {
pub bucket_info: VectorBucketInfo,
}
pub struct GetVectorBucket;
impl Ops for GetVectorBucket {
type Response = BodyResponseProcessor<GetVectorBucketResult>;
type Body = NoneBody;
type Query = GetVectorBucketParams;
fn prepare(self) -> Result<Prepared<GetVectorBucketParams>> {
Ok(Prepared {
method: Method::GET,
query: Some(GetVectorBucketParams::default()),
..Default::default()
})
}
}
pub trait GetVectorBucketOps {
fn get_vector_bucket(&self) -> impl Future<Output = Result<GetVectorBucketResult>>;
}
impl GetVectorBucketOps for Client {
async fn get_vector_bucket(&self) -> Result<GetVectorBucketResult> {
self.request(GetVectorBucket).await
}
}
#[cfg(test)]
mod tests {
use super::*;
#[test]
fn params_serialize() {
assert_eq!(crate::ser::to_string(&GetVectorBucketParams::default()).unwrap(), "bucketInfo");
}
#[test]
fn parse_response() {
let json = r#"{
"BucketInfo": {
"CreationDate": "2013-07-31T10:56:21.000Z",
"ExtranetEndpoint": "cn-hangzhou.oss-vectors.aliyuncs.com",
"IntranetEndpoint": "cn-hangzhou-internal.oss-vectors.aliyuncs.com",
"Location": "oss-cn-hangzhou",
"Name": "acs:ossvector:cn-shanghai:103735**********:examplebucket",
"Region": "cn-hangzhou"
}
}"#;
let parsed: GetVectorBucketResult = serde_json::from_str(json).unwrap();
assert!(parsed.bucket_info.name.starts_with("acs:ossvector:"));
assert_eq!(parsed.bucket_info.region.as_deref(), Some("cn-hangzhou"));
}
}
